Chapada Diamantina is an erosional landform in the state of Bahia, Brazil. The Chapada Diamantina runs from North to South in the middle of Bahia and is an extension of the Espinhaco Range System. The rocks in the system date back to Pangaea and erosion of the formation began in the Precambrian eon. The Range System has an erosional outlier that exposes a contact, the Pai Inacio Anticlilne. The Pai Inacio Anticline is 25km wide and exposes the sedimentary rocks of the Paraguacu group. At the contact there are two different rock groups exposed one being the Chapada Diamantina and the Paraguacu, with the Chapada Diamantinea overlaying the Paraguacu group. The two rock groups not only in elasticity but in composition as well. The Chapada Diamantina is primarily compsed of sandstone, pelites and diamond bearing conglomerates. The Paraguacu is composed of fine-grained sandstones, siltstones and argillites. The rocks of the Paraguacu are softer and therefore more sucptible to weathering and folding. It is the folds in the Paraguacu that allows for the entry of water into the rock’s structure which in turn is responsible for the erosion.
